Understanding the Map

Once you have the Minnesota State Fair map in hand (or on your screen), understanding its symbols and layout is crucial for effective navigation. The map is designed to be comprehensive, including details about everything from food vendors to first aid stations.

Key Landmarks and Attractions

The map clearly marks major landmarks and attractions within the fairgrounds. This includes iconic spots like the Grandstand, the Dairy Building (home of the butter sculptures!), the Agriculture Horticulture Building, and the various animal barns. Identifying these key landmarks helps you orient yourself and plan your route efficiently. Pay attention to the symbols used to represent each attraction, as these are usually explained in a legend on the map.

Transportation and Parking

The map also provides information about transportation options and parking facilities. This includes the locations of park-and-ride lots, bus stops, and designated drop-off zones. Understanding the transportation layout helps you plan your arrival and departure efficiently, avoiding unnecessary delays or confusion. The map may also indicate accessible parking areas for visitors with disabilities.

Preparing for the 2025 Fair

As the 2025 Minnesota State Fair approaches, preparation is key to maximizing your enjoyment. Beyond just having the map, here’s what you should keep in mind.

Check the Weather

Minnesota weather can be unpredictable, even in late summer. Check the forecast leading up to and during your visit. Dress appropriately for the weather conditions, and be prepared for potential rain or heat. Consider bringing sunscreen, a hat, and a poncho or umbrella.

Wear Comfortable Shoes

You'll be doing a lot of walking at the fair, so comfortable shoes are essential. Choose supportive footwear that can withstand hours of standing and walking on various surfaces. Avoid wearing new shoes that might cause blisters or discomfort.

Stay Hydrated

It’s easy to get dehydrated, especially on hot days. Bring a reusable water bottle and refill it at water fountains throughout the fairgrounds. Avoid sugary drinks that can actually dehydrate you further. Staying hydrated helps you stay energized and comfortable throughout the day.

Plan for Crowds

The Minnesota State Fair is a popular event, and crowds are to be expected. Plan for longer wait times at popular attractions and food vendors. Arrive early in the day to avoid the biggest crowds, or consider visiting on a weekday if possible. Be patient and courteous to other fairgoers.

Budget Accordingly

The fair can be expensive, especially if you plan to indulge in a lot of food and souvenirs. Set a budget beforehand and stick to it. Consider bringing cash, as some vendors may not accept credit cards. Look for deals and discounts to save money, such as early bird specials or coupon books.
